[Detailed Description of the Invention] It would be convenient if an alarm could be issued when an object that needs to be prevented from being left behind, such as a lost child, leaves a certain distance. Although there is a means of communication in the coverage area, there is no such method yet in place in the breakaway area. The present invention receives weak radio waves from a transmitting unit attached to an object at the receiving unit of the wearer when necessary, and issues an alarm when the transmitting unit leaves the receiving area, and is also equipped with a corresponding guarantee circuit. To explain this in more detail in the drawings, the transmitting section 1 is normally engaged with the receiving section 2 as one unit, and during that time, the circuit of the oscillating power source 3 and the circuit of the receiving power source 4 are connected.
The transmitting power circuit switch S1 and the receiving power circuit switch S2 are opened respectively, but the transmitter 1 and the receiver 2 are opened.
At the same time, each circuit is closed by a micro switch or the like, and the transmitter circuit 5 of the transmitter 1 is activated to transmit weak radio waves such as high frequency waves.At the same time, the receiver 2
The high frequency amplification circuit 6, the local oscillation circuit 7, the mixing circuit 8, the intermediate frequency amplification circuit 9, and the receivable detection circuit (squelch circuit or its equivalent circuit) 10, which constitute this circuit, operate to detect the receivable state of 0 and 1. The alarm is generated by the alarm sound generator 11 through the gate IC section I which detects the signal, and when the signal cannot be received, an alarm is issued.

Since the oscillation power supply circuit switch S of the transmitting section 1 can be turned off by pressing it manually, when the transmitting section 1 and the receiving section 2 are disconnected, press it.
When the alarm sound of the receiving part 2 does not sound, the power supply 3 of the transmitting part 1
Since it can be confirmed that the circuit is worn out, it is convenient for checking the guarantee circuit. Furthermore, since guaranteeing the receiving power source 4 is also important, the receiving section 2 is provided with an IC section I' for detecting the power supply voltage of the receiving power source 4 to detect the diode circuit H. In other words, when an alarm sounds, (1) the transmitting power supply is exhausted. (2) The receiving power supply has been exhausted. (3) The transmitting unit 1 has moved away from the receiving unit 2 and has entered an area where reception is not possible. Both are guaranteed to be on the safe side.
